One of my favorite platformers for the nes is an awesome game known as Power Blade. It is pretty much a clone of mega man but it is actually a pretty awesome game and would recommend anybody give it a try. The music is pretty good, the weapons and levels very well designed and the bosses are actually pretty fun to go against.

Another platformer I absolutely adored is Little Nemo: The Dream-master. It is a very difficult platformer but it is actually really good despite its difficulty.
For the snes, it is pretty easy to pick out the great platformers for that system especially when you have games such as Super Metroid, Donkey Kong Country, Castlevania IV, and Mega Man X.
I think the Disney Games did an excellent job with the platforming formula. Games such as The Lion King, Aladdin, and my personal favorite Magical Quest starring Mickey Mouse are all excellent platforming games.
